This book provides an introduction of how radiation is processed in
polymeric materials, how materials properties are affected and how
the resulting materials are analyzed. It covers synthesis,
characterization, or modification of important materials, e.g.
polycarbonates, polyamides and polysaccharides, using radiation.
For example, a complete chapter is dedicated to the
characterization of biodegradable polymers irradiated with low and
heavy ions. This book will be beneficial to all polymer scientists
in the development of new macromolecules and to all engineers using
these materials in applications. It summarizes the fundamental
knowledge and latest innovations in research fields from medicine
to space.
